Consultation Rooms

Consultations rooms are available for use by ophthalmologists on a regular or per session basis. The rooms are equipped with a slit-lamp, tonometer and Snellen chart.

Terms and Conditions for use of consulting rooms



All practitioners wishing to rent rooms at LEDC whether on an annual or per session basis will be required to provide photocopies of:

  • Contemporaneous Curriculum Vitae

  • GMC or other Professional Body registration

  • Professional Indemnity Certificate

  • Criminal Records Bureau (CRB) Disclosure Certificate (where appropriate)

  • Two (2) professional references

 

Practitioners are also required provide a written declaration that they are competent to use relevant equipment and are licensed/certified where appropriate.

Payment

All fees are to be paid quarterly, in advance.

 

Notice Period(s)

Annual Rental Agreements

A minimum period of two (2) months is required by both parties unless a breach of these Terms and Conditions has occurred.

 

Per Session Rental Agreements

A minimum period of four (4) weeks is required by both parties unless a breach of these Terms and Conditions has occurred.

 

Review

Both parties will be afforded the opportunity to review the rental and working agreements on a quarterly basis. Options for change can of course be considered here.

 

LEDC Policies and Procedures

All practitioners will comply with LEDC policies and procedures at all times. A copy of these is available from the Practice Manager or the Directors.

 

LEDC is registered with the Healthcare Commission, and as such, users will be required to comply with their existing and any future registration standards and/or other requirements.
